首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

应用于集合与行的更新赋值

是指在数据库中对集合和行进行更新操作时,使用特定的赋值语句来修改数据。这种操作可以通过编程语言或数据库管理系统的命令来实现。

在数据库中,集合是一组相关的数据项的无序集合,而行是数据库表中的一条记录。更新赋值操作可以用于修改集合中的数据项或修改行中的字段值。

优势:

  1. 灵活性:更新赋值操作可以根据具体需求对集合和行进行精确的修改,可以更新特定的数据项或字段,而不会影响其他数据。
  2. 效率:更新赋值操作可以快速地修改集合和行中的数据,提高数据处理的效率。
  3. 可扩展性:更新赋值操作可以根据业务需求进行扩展,满足不同的数据更新需求。

应用场景:

  1. 数据库管理:更新赋值操作常用于数据库管理中,用于修改数据库中的数据,如更新用户信息、修改订单状态等。
  2. 数据分析:更新赋值操作可以用于对数据进行清洗和转换,以便进行后续的数据分析和挖掘工作。
  3. 实时数据处理:更新赋值操作可以用于实时数据处理场景,如实时监控系统中的数据更新和状态变化。

推荐的腾讯云相关产品和产品介绍链接地址:

请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

PLSQL 集合初始化赋值

对于集合类型,单一数据类型相比较而言,应该以一个整体观念来考虑集合,即是一批类型相同数据组合而非单一数据。因此集 合类型集合声明、赋值、初始化较之单一类型而言,有很大不同。...有关集合类型描述请参考: PL/SQL 联合数组嵌套表 PL/SQL 变长数组 PL/SQL --> PL/SQL记录 一、联合数组赋值     联合数组不需要初始化,直接赋值即可。...|| ') value is ' || loc_tab( v_counter ) ); END LOOP; END; 二、集合初始化赋值 1、初始化方法      集合类型主要分为三步来完成...而联合数组不需要初始化而直接进行赋值。 2、在声明嵌套表变长数组时,这些集合类型会被自动置为NULL,即集合不存在任何元素。而不是集合元素为NULL。...9、集合集合之间赋值需要声明为同一类型变量之间才可以赋值,否则收到错误提示。

2.3K50

python中字典中赋值技巧,update批量更新、比较setdefault方法等于赋值

例如:dic1["aa"]="刘金玉" 二、字典批量更新 一个个更新字典处理方式有时候比较慢,我们在实际项目的应用中其实更多是对字典进行批量更新赋值。那么该如何进行批量更新呢?...我们这里举例使用字典自带update方法进行批量更新赋值。...这里我们归纳了使用update更新字典数据注意事项: 字典键值对特性: 1.后更新值会覆盖前面已有的键对应值。...2.新字典数据键如果和原来字典数据键相同,那么以新字典数据键对应值作为新值,更新了原有的键值对。 三、总结强调 1.掌握setdefault方法普通字典赋值区别。...2.批量更新字典数据可以采用update方法,理解键值对注意事项。 3.掌握指针赋值、浅层复制、深层复制之间区别。 4.掌握字典声明基本赋值、取值。

5.9K20
  • MongoDB系列8:MongoDB集合增量更新

    本文是第8篇,主要讲述MongoDB集合增量更新实战经验,非常值得一看。...,有时为了方便,只更新变化数据,即增量更新。...图2 场景二:现在student集合和target集合有一样数据,后续如果student集合数据有变化,target集合需要根据student集合数据进行更新,而且每次只需要更新变化数据,即增量更新...使用以下语句来是实现集合增量更新: 1)先向student集合新增一个文档和修改s_id学号为001文档: db.student.insert({"_id":15,"s_id":"006","c_id...图4 说明: query:对应是查询文档,用于检索文档条件; update: 对应修改器文档,用于更新所找到文档; upsert: 指当没有文档匹配时,是否插入; 场景三:多集合关联增量更新另一个集合

    2.8K30

    python基础(9)增强型赋值使用普通赋值区别

    前言 增强型赋值语句是经常被使用到,因为从各种学习渠道中,我们能够得知i += 1效率往往要比 i = i + 1 更高一些(这里以 += 为例,实际上增强型赋值语句不仅限于此)。...所以我们会乐此不疲在任何能够替换普通赋值语句地方使用增量型赋值语句,以此来优化代码。那么我们是否有想过,在什么情况下 i += 1 其实并不等效于 i = i + 1 !!...a,目前a和b共用一片内存地址,关键点:b = b + [4, 5, 6],是在原来b基础上,添加了一个列表,并且将新赋值给了左边b,原先b内存地址是指向a,但是现在又重新赋值了,所以b重新开辟了一片新内存地址...同时在前文中也提到,增强赋值语句比普通赋值语句效率更高,这是因为在 Python 源码中, 增强赋值比普通赋值多实现了“写回”功能,也就是说增强赋值在条件符合情况下(例如:操作数是一个可变类型对象...)会以追加方式来进行处理,而普通赋值则会以新建方式进行处理。

    59020

    《ECMAScript 6 入门》【二、变量解构赋值】(持续更新中……)

    前言:让我们看下es6新语法解构,跟模式匹配类似。...一、数组解构赋值举个例子给多个变量赋值写法:var a =1;var b =2;var c =3;需要写多个变量特别麻烦,我们先使用以前简化方法。...var a=1,b=2,c=3;现在es6引入了解构,我们可以使用数组解构赋值来更简便进行赋值。1、完全解构let [a,b,c]=[1,2,3];可以从数组中提取值,按照对应位置,对变量赋值。...本质上,这种写法属于“模式匹配”,只要等号两边模式相同,左边变量就会被赋予对应值。...就是等号左边模式,只匹配一部分等号右边数组let [x, y] = [1, 2, 3];x // 1y // 2let [a, [b], d] = [1, [2, 3], 4];a // 1b /

    98920

    VBA中数组、集合和字典(二)——对数组变量赋值

    上次我们对比学习了一下ExcelVBA中数组、集合和字典概念和声明语法,我个人觉得在声明部分,三者区别还是挺大。...下面我们一块学习一下赋值方面的知识点,因为内容较多,我们今天就先学习一下给数组变量赋值内容 三、赋值 不管是数组、集合还是字典,都有向变量赋值操作,赋值也是这几个概念核心和关键,操作也有很大不同。...1.向数组变量赋值 对数组来说,数组中每个元素数据类型必须相同,从数组声明就可以看出,这是数组集合和字典明显不同。这就要求向数组变量赋值数据规范必须严格。...image.png a.向数组中单个数组元素赋值 当数组已经确定了长度,我们就可以对数组内元素进行赋值。...b.向数组变量整体赋值 整体赋值意思就是把一个数组直接赋值给数组变量,而不是通过对单个数组元素赋值

    6.9K30

    集合转数组方法_数组集合区别

    Object[] toArrays() E[] toArrays(E[] e); 有时候 需要让集合围成数组,因为有时需要限定对集合元素操作,不需要对该元素进行增删。...这里我们 可以 使用是Collection接口中toArray方法。 在使用toArray方法时,可以传入一个指定类型数组。 那么toArray会返回该类型数组并存储了集合元素。...给toArray方法传递数组长度该怎么定义呢? 如果传入数组长度小于集合长度,那么该toArray方法内部会建立一个新该类型数组,并长度和集合一致,来存储集合元素。...如果传入数组长度大于集合长度,那么就使用传入数组存储集合元素,没有存储数据位置为null。 所以传入数组时,该数组长度最好定义成集合长度。这就是刚刚好数组。...System.out.println(list);//输出[3,1,5] PS:数组转成集合,不可进行增删操作(运行异常),可以替换(数组变量会有影响) 若想增删,将元素存入新集合

    59910

    类成员初始化赋值

    y = yy; } 其中,x 以构造函数特有的语法(初始化列表)形式被初始化,而 y 则在构造函数中被赋值。...以上两种做法显然都可以使得在类对象调用构造函数之后,保证 x 和 y 值都是确定数,但我们要牢记是,初始化(initialization)和普通赋值(assignment)语句是有区别的,他们区别是...: 初始化发生时机比赋值要早。...初始化发生时刻实际上是程序刚刚开始运行时候,而赋值语句则要等到程序执行到该语句才开始。 初始化执行效率比赋值要高。...事实上,类成员数据在构造函数中被赋值之前,已经被系统进行过一次 default 初始化,因此赋值语句相当于抹掉了先前初始化执行效果,使得系统做了一次无用功。

    1.1K20

    Java集合 Map 集合 操作集合工具类: Collections 详细说明

    Java集合 Map 集合 操作集合工具类: Collections 详细说明图片***每博一文案别把人生,输给心情师父说:心情不是人生全部,却能左右人生全部。...—— 情况2 * 如果 **key1** hashCode() 哈希值 已经存在数据哈希值都 **相等**, 则调用 **key1** 元素所在类 **equals()** 方法,, 判断比较所存储内容是否和集合中存储相等... LinkedHashSet 类似, LinkedHashMap 可以维护 Map 迭代顺序:迭代顺序 Key-Value 键值对插入顺序一致,简单说就是:存取顺序一样。...关于自然排序 定制排序 详解内容大家可以移步至: 比较器: Comparable Comparator 区别_ChinaRainbowSea博客-CSDN博客TreeMap 判断两个 Key...提供getProperty方法并行性 。 强制使用字符串属性键和值。 返回值是Hashtable调用put结果。简单说:就是向Property 集合中添加键值对元素。

    94120

    Go 专栏|变量和常量声明赋值

    原文链接: Go 专栏|变量和常量声明赋值 上篇文章介绍了环境搭建,并完成了学习 Go 第一个程序 Hello World。这篇文章继续学习 Go 基础知识,来看看变量,常量声明赋值。...注意 := 和 = 区别,前者是声明并赋值,后者是赋值。 这种初始化方式非常方便,在局部变量声明和初始化时经常使用。...: // 变量赋值 var m, n int m = 9 n = 10 fmt.Println(m, n) 多重赋值: // 变量赋值 var m, n int m = 9 n = 10 m, n =...n, m fmt.Println(m, n) 这个特性真是很爽,想想在 C 语言中是不能这么做,要实现相同效果,必须要借助一个中间变量才。...其中短变量方式在声明局部变量时经常使用,而且还要注意不要和赋值 = 弄混。 常量声明和变量类似,只需要把 var 换成 const 即可。 常量还有一种特殊声明方式,使用 iota。

    1.1K10

    Python中字典集合

    今天我们来讲一讲python中字典集合 Dictionary:字典     Set:集合 字典语法: Dictionary字典(键值对) 语法: dictionary = {key:value,...print(i) 因为清空了所以是没有输出结果 集合语法: setName = [value1,value2,value3,value4] setName:集合名 valueN:值 下面我们创建一个集合...同时在字典中也对应着相应值, 不过如果下标在集合中相对应没有值,那么就会出现报错:索引越界)  输出索引为0对应值 print(stus[0]) 输出结果如下: 巩祎鹏 同时集合也有类似于字符串切边...String基本内置函数过滤字符串模块函数基本用法》 《第六章python中字典集合》 我觉得讲也差不多了,python基础也就这么多了.后续都是爬虫,人工智能,大数据一些相关问题了,...这些东西我学还不是很熟练,也就是在这些方面我还是个newbie,所以我决定缓一阵子,等我将这些领域多少有一些涉及以及有一些自己学习笔记见解时候再与大家各位读者分享.

    1.7K30

    Java中集合IO

    集合类中主要有几种接口? Collection:是集合List、Set、Queue最基本接口。 Iterator:迭代器,可以通过迭代器遍历集合内容。 Map:是映射表基础接口。...集合中泛型优点 保证了类型安全性:泛型约束了变量类型,保证了类型安全性。 避免了不必要得装箱、拆箱操作,提高了程序性能:泛型变量固定了类型,在使用时就已经知道是值类型还是引用类型。...如何选用集合类 -- 需要根据键值对获取元素则采用Map接口下集合 需要排序时选用TreeMap 无需排序时选用HashMap 需要保证线程安全可以采用ConcurrentHashMap -- 只需存放元素则采用...HashMapTreeMap区别 二者都继承自AbstractMap,但TreeMap还实现了NavigableMapSortedMap接口,使得TreeMap还拥有对集合内元素进行搜索以及根据键值进行排序能力...CollectionCollections之间区别 Collection是集合上级接口,继承自它接口主要是setlist Collections则是针对集合一个工具类,提供了诸如排序、

    1.2K20
    领券